I have CIDRS in a group of cows and heifers that I am going to remove tomorrow. Does it matter what time they are taken out? I know the ones in the heifers are staying in 6 hours longer than the cows, but I didn't know if I had to take them out of the cows around the time of day they were put in, or if it didn't matter. I was told it didn't matter as long as they are bred a certain amount of time later, but I'm not sure.

It does not matter from how long you put them in, but DOES matter when you target time to AI is. The way I always figured it was the time I was expecting to AI, then backed up to when to give shots and pull CIDR's, depending on what protocol you are using.

Here is an example of a protocol we used in the fall:
Put in CIRDR's and give GnRH (day -5) on Nov 18th
Pull CIDR's, give 5ml Lute between 8:30-9AM on 23rd
Give second Lute shot at 8:30 PM (12 hours later)
two of four (one cow and one heifer) were standing in the AM on the 25th
third cow was standing 8 AM in the 26th, and last cow was standing at noon on the 26th
With all, we gave GnRH at breeding time (12 hours after standing).

Our ET guy has had us leave the CIDR's in an extra day before so the cow would come in on a more convenient day for him. It does not matter WHEN you pull, just that you follow the time line from the hour you actually pull the CIDR. As always, watching for heat closely really helps! We heat detect 3 times a day minimum. Especially when we are using CIDR's.

Are you going to time AI or are you going to heat detect & breed off of standing heats? If you are time breeding, decide how many hours + or - after pulling the cidrs that you are breeding and work backwards from the time that you want to be breeding the cows to figure out when you need to pull your cidrs. hours after pulling cidrs to time of insemination will be different for cows verses first calf heifers.
